About The Position

Performs a variety of skilled and semi-skilled building maintenance and repair tasks, with primary responsibility for electrical repairs and work in the designated electrical trade. Assists other trades as needed, including carpentry, plumbing, and sign shop work. This position is Emergency Essential and may be required to work during emergency activation.
